No sales spike from London 2012 - SIG
23rd August 2012
SIG today said the Olympic Games had had little "discernible effect" on its UK operations as the insulation and building products distributor posted a "resilient" half year performance.
Sheffield-based SIG saw statutory half-year pre-tax profits reach £25.2m for the six months to June 30.
Underlying pre-tax profits, stripping out various costs, were £34.7m, down from £35.4m over the same period last year. Group revenues on continuing operations were down 3.8% at £1.29bn.
